R&D- Sr. Group Leader

The Sherwin-Williams Company
$96522 - $123866 Annually
United States, North Carolina, Greensboro
Jul 29, 2025

The Industrial Wood Laboratory is seeking a Senior Group Leader to lead the development and commercialization efforts for new and existing products designed for Industrial Wood Market Segments. This individual will work closely with Industrial Wood Sales and Marketing to identify the needs and timelines for product development projects and will coordinate project activities with all the pertinent functions within SW.

* Align departmental activities to deliver on strategic goals for the Company in the areas of New Product Development.
* Create opportunities and building strategic relationships, both internal and external.
* Identifying high performing employees and build a cohesive and productive team to meet complex project solutions.
* Effectively manage time and resources to ensure that projects work is delivered on long- and short-term goals.
* Conduct formal performance reviews and addressing performance concerns
* Effectively communicating projects and deliverables to team
* Identify and understanding customer and project issues, while providing and implementing best course of action.
* Create a culture of diversity and inclusion, along with a positive cooperative work environment.
* Facilitate the professional and technical growth of team members
* Written and verbal communication of team and project related information to key stakeholders and Senior Management
* Communicate/interface with other departments and divisions including Technical, Marketing, Operations, Quality, Competitive, Supply Chain, Market Product Manager, Analytical.

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
* Must be legally authorized to work in the country for which you are applying for employment (without now or in the future needing sponsorship for employment work visa and/or permanent residence status).
* Bachelor's degree in a Science, Technology, Engineering or Math field.
* Must be at least 18 years of age.
* 5 years of experience in coating formulation and applications
* 4 years of experience in managing/supervising direct report(s)
* Must have previous project management experience
* Must have a minimum of 5 years new product development experience

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
* 10+ years of product development and/or commercialization experience is preferred
* Knowledge or experience in Industrial Wood coating formulations and processing is preferred
* Knowledge of the Industrial Coatings market and regulations
* Training in Design of Experiments and Design for Six Sigma
* Proven successful project management (of multiple projects) and leadership skills

Travel Requirements: 20% Domestic and International
